Hi Deb. Changing the battery wont fix anything. All that battery does is save the programming to the controller in case the power goes out. It wont actually run the sprinkler system.
Maybe you reset the controller without knowing it. If you unplug the controller and take out the battery this will reset the controller. I'm guessing that you probably reprogrammed the controller and now it's working.
Or you just think it's working because you have a display again because of the fresh battery.
